This book discusses various aspects for consideration while designing a bioreactor with particular emphasis to those reactions that require light, and thus the reaction unit is called PhotoBioReactor. Various designs dominant in the industry are discussed with their pros-and-cons and various limiting reaction conditions are discussed which are important during automation consideration such as by means of a chemostat unit or linked to a Computer unit that has a synchronous deep learning or machine learning module to match up with the growth rate required for the bio-based chemicals of interest or the microbial organism such as algae, cyanobacteria, etc. Please note that the details of machine learning and deep learning algorithms are not discussed in this book as they are fairly straightforward that can be deployed to a Computer unit connected to various sensors for reading pH, dissolved Oxygen, dissolved Carbón Dioxide, etc. The book discusses granted patent application nr: 1135/DEL/2006 and walks through various steps needed with example culture of algae, inoculation, different reagents & equipments needed & the various calculations done to design the bioreactor.
